Home > Php Cannot > Php Cannot Load Module Pdo_mysql

Php Cannot Load Module Pdo_mysql

Contents

asked 1 year ago viewed 141 times active 1 year ago Upcoming Events 2016 Community Moderator Election ends Nov 22 Related 2786How can I prevent SQL injection in PHP?0PHP error log so big thx for the nice grep line. –DanFromGermany Jul 24 '13 at 10:15 1 @GeppettvsD'Constanzo When upgrading, sometimes it will prompt you whether to overwrite the config file. Can Trump undo the UN climate change agreement? Some functions on this portal require JavaScript but your browser does not support it or it has been disabled.

sky05-07-2008, 05:08 AMHello To check if PDO is loaded, create a php file and do a echo phpinfo(); and check if PDO is there. In my case the correct path should be: extension=/usr/lib/php5/20131226/mcrypt.so That's it! Hans Ps. That's why I said "Change this path if yours is different." :) jazzy03-14-2008, 08:07 AMAfter painstakingly trying to follow this (I'm a newbie so it took some time to find configure.php http://share.ez.no/forums/install-configuration/cannot-load-module-pdo_mysql

Pdo_mysql.so: Undefined Symbol: Pdo_parse_params In Unknown On Line 0

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ed TROUBLESHOOTING A) If you are receiving the following warning/error: PHP Warning: PHP Startup: Invalid library (maybe not a PHP library) 'pdo_mysql.so' in Unknown on line 0 Try restarting mysqld first. I had the same problem and did the following: Uninstall php with purge parameter: sudo apt-get --purge remove php5-common And install again: sudo apt-get install php5 php5-mysql share|improve this answer answered What is the output of this grep?

GXX03-16-2008, 10:35 AMHere's my configure.php_ap2: #!/bin/sh ./configure \ --with-apxs2 \ --with-curl \ --with-curl-dir=/usr/local/lib \ --with-gd \ --with-gd-dir=/usr/local/lib \ --with-gettext \ --with-jpeg-dir=/usr/local/lib \ --with-kerberos \ --with-openssl \ --with-mcrypt \ --with-mhash \ --with-mysql=/usr Let's get started. 1) First off, issue this command to check your pear/pecl config: pecl config-show This will show you your config. I read the bug report mentioned by smtalk, but can't find anything there that I haven't tried. :( Ideas, anyone? PHP_PDO_SHARED=1 pecl install PDO_MYSQL ...and following result came up, at the end of the log: ----------------------------------------------------------------------- running: make INSTALL_ROOT="/var/tmp/pear-build-root/install-PDO_MYSQL-1.0.2" install Installing shared extensions: /var/tmp/pear-build-root/install-PDO_MYSQL-1.0.2/usr/local/lib/php/extensions/no-debug-non-zts-20060613/ running: find "/var/tmp/pear-build-root/install-PDO_MYSQL-1.0.2" -ls 573852 4 drwxr-xr-x

share|improve this answer answered May 13 '13 at 14:21 dimcha 11112 add a comment| up vote 7 down vote Seems like you upgraded PHP to newer version and old .ini files Starting to download PDO_MYSQL-1.0.2.tgz (14,778 bytes) .....done: 14,778 bytes downloading PDO-1.0.3.tgz ... For some reason this happened to me with the default install of Ubuntu, so hopefully this helps someone else. Using DSolve with a boundary condition at -Infinity What does "there lived here then" mean?

ERROR: `phpize' failed Any ideas? Would we find alien music meaningful? Install pdo_mysql (I not use pecl because I mounted /tmp with noexec and do not want to reconfig path so I just down load the tar and compile) wget http://pecl.php.net/get/PDO_MYSQL-1.0.2.tgz tar Ofc you'd have to do it with each module giving you an error.

Php Warning Php Startup Unable To Load Dynamic Library '/usr/local/lib/php/extensions/

On 1941 Dec 7, could Japan have destroyed the Panama Canal instead of Pearl Harbor in a surprise attack? no checking for nawk... Pdo_mysql.so: Undefined Symbol: Pdo_parse_params In Unknown On Line 0 Browse other questions tagged php or ask your own question. Pdo_mysql Extension Is Not Installed cp /usr/local/lib/php/extensions/no-debug-non-zts-20060613/* /usr/local/lib/ and edit php.ini (/usr/local/lib/php.ini) to (for future :D ) extension_dir = "/usr/local/lib/" :cool: GXX03-06-2008, 06:44 PMThat works too.

Does Intel sell CPUs in ribbons? So the easy solution is simply to tell PHP to stop trying to load them: First, find out which files are trying to load the above extensions: $ grep -Hrv ";" Help eZ Systems Follow the eZ Publish community on Twitter eZ Ecosystem on LinkedIn All In this section Search text: Skip to main content Get involved Events Forums eZ Platform eZ PHP 5.3.2 Installed.

What crime would be illegal to uncover in medieval Europe? How can I take a powerful plot item away from players without frustrating them? I just recently had to do this so I thought I might as well share. yes checking build system type...

Why is (a % 256) different than (a & 0xFF)? C++ calculator using classes How does Gandalf end up on the roof of Isengard? My install of ISPConfig is working fine.

Why "silver-tongued" for someone who is convincing?

This error happens when you remove some php packages not so cleanly. yes checking for system library directory... Because it has attracted low-quality or spam answers that had to be removed, posting an answer now requires 10 reputation on this site (the association bonus does not count). Not the answer you're looking for?

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Changed extensions dir path in php.ini, added the extensions. GXX04-03-2008, 07:04 AMIt sounds like your /tmp is mounted as noexec. Starting to download PDO-1.0.3.tgz (52,613 bytes) ...done: 52,613 bytes 12 source files, building running: phpize Configuring for: PHP Api Version: 20041225 Zend Module Api No: 20060613 Zend Extension Api No: 220060519

What now? I have spend hours on this. Aug 9 '07 #1 Post Reply Share this Question 2 Replies Expert 100+ P: 1,044 kovik Look for that extension in your php.ini file and uncomment the line. And here we go! /home/tmp/PDO-1.0.3/pdo_dbh.c: In function 'pdo_stmt_instantiate': /home/tmp/PDO-1.0.3/pdo_dbh.c:410: error: 'zval' has no member named 'refcount' /home/tmp/PDO-1.0.3/pdo_dbh.c:411: error: 'zval' has no member named 'is_ref' /home/tmp/PDO-1.0.3/pdo_dbh.c: In function 'pdo_stmt_construct': /home/tmp/PDO-1.0.3/pdo_dbh.c:435: error: 'zend_fcall_info'

The PECL installation system assumes that one can run scripts from the /tmp directory. All rights reserved. I've added the extensions to the php.ini file... Nobody encountering this on dsm5?